Fans of the K-pop boy group EXO are overjoyed as Kai officially completed his military duties on Monday, February 10, after serving for almost two years in the Army Training Center.
He enlisted in May 2023, where he underwent five weeks of basic military training and is set to complete his social service duties on Monday.
As of now, EXO’s Sehun is the only remaining member whose military service is set to conclude on September 20.
EXO’s Chanyeol has hinted at the group’s future plans during the “SM Town Live” in January, stating that once all members have reunited, they will show something great for their fans.
“Kai will be out soon, and although Sehun has a little time left, it won’t be long before we can reunite and show you something great,” Chanyeol said. “In fact, we’re already discussing plans.”
